    Freeing up from legislation...sort of. I have no problem whatsoever making appropriate accommodation for them, and we need too as a country. new houses don't have penetrable lofts and these creatures need to live somewhere. If we don't have them we'd have lots more clothes moths and nasty insects.

    there needs to be a balance: some projects shouldn't have to wait for bats: if the project is urgent for the preservation of the building, others should be asked to wait, provide the alternative, then seal gaps at the right time (this is our plan and I think the right move for here and then majority of projects). we've also adapted out plans to allow place for them in the finished building, if they want to come back then.

    Expecting people to put the bats heating requirements before their own, not as an equal consideration but a greater one, is IMO batty.
